19 #define NUM_DEFAULT_KEYS 4
20 #define NUM_DEFAULT_MGMT_KEYS 2
22 #define WEP_IV_LEN 4
23 #define WEP_ICV_LEN 4
24 #define ALG_CCMP_KEY_LEN 16
25 #define CCMP_HDR_LEN 8
26 #define CCMP_MIC_LEN 8
27 #define CCMP_TK_LEN 16
28 #define CCMP_PN_LEN 6
29 #define TKIP_IV_LEN 8
30 #define TKIP_ICV_LEN 4
31 #define CMAC_PN_LEN 6
33 #define NUM_RX_DATA_QUEUES 16

39 /**
40 * enum ieee80211_internal_key_flags - internal key flags
42 * @KEY_FLAG_UPLOADED_TO_HARDWARE: Indicates that this key is present
43 * in the hardware for TX crypto hardware acceleration.
45 enum ieee80211_internal_key_flags {
46 KEY_FLAG_UPLOADED_TO_HARDWARE = BIT(0),
49 enum ieee80211_internal_tkip_state {
50 TKIP_STATE_NOT_INIT,
51 TKIP_STATE_PHASE1_DONE,
52 TKIP_STATE_PHASE1_HW_UPLOADED,
55 struct tkip_ctx {
56 u32 iv32; /* current iv32 */
57 u16 iv16; /* current iv16 */
58 u16 p1k[5]; /* p1k cache */
59 u32 p1k_iv32; /* iv32 for which p1k computed */
60 enum ieee80211_internal_tkip_state state;
63 struct ieee80211_key {
64 struct ieee80211_local *local;
65 struct ieee80211_sub_if_data *sdata;
66 struct sta_info *sta;
68 /* for sdata list */
69 struct list_head list;
71 /* protected by key mutex */
72 unsigned int flags;
74 union {
75 struct {
76 /* protects tx context */
77 spinlock_t txlock;
79 /* last used TSC */
80 struct tkip_ctx tx;
82 /* last received RSC */
83 struct tkip_ctx rx[NUM_RX_DATA_QUEUES];
84 } tkip;
85 struct {
86 atomic64_t tx_pn;
88 * Last received packet number. The first
89 * NUM_RX_DATA_QUEUES counters are used with Data
90 * frames and the last counter is used with Robust
91 * Management frames.
93 u8 rx_pn[NUM_RX_DATA_QUEUES + 1][CCMP_PN_LEN];
94 struct crypto_cipher *tfm;
95 u32 replays; /* dot11RSNAStatsCCMPReplays */
96 } ccmp;
97 struct {
98 atomic64_t tx_pn;
99 u8 rx_pn[CMAC_PN_LEN];
100 struct crypto_cipher *tfm;
101 u32 replays; /* dot11RSNAStatsCMACReplays */
102 u32 icverrors; /* dot11RSNAStatsCMACICVErrors */
103 } aes_cmac;
104 } u;
106 /* number of times this key has been used */
107 int tx_rx_count;
109 #ifdef CONFIG_MAC80211_DEBUGFS
110 struct {
111 struct dentry *stalink;
112 struct dentry *dir;
113 int cnt;
114 } debugfs;
115 #endif
118 * key config, must be last because it contains key
119 * material as variable length member
121 struct ieee80211_key_conf conf;
